Runbook 9.1 — Trophy engraving, Silverline Awards Night

Engraved trophies from Hollowbrook Engravers are to be logged by the records team on receipt, photographed, and matched against the winners list held by the ceremony committee. Any spelling discrepancy must be flagged before packing. Completed trophies are crated for transfer to the Ferngate venue.

The confidential courier hand-over instruction is recorded directly beneath this entry.

courier memo of tawep-tajep: the quenius ulaiel courier leaves the fenir ledger at gate 9128 under passcode 527513

## Read-Replica Lag Alarm (Corvid DB)

Fires when Corvid replica lag exceeds 45 seconds for 5 minutes. Usual causes: long-running analytics queries or a vacuum storm on the primary. First step is to kill offending queries on the replica, not the primary. Replication topology diagrams and the query kill procedure are on the internal page below.

operations page: https://jenkins.zemvarcloud.local/job/merge_requests/repo/build/73930b4b30f0a8ed

### Runbook: BounceBroom — Account Recovery

If the BounceBroom email bounce processor loses access to its service account, do not create a new one. First, pause the intake queue so bounces buffer safely. Then open the recovery console and select the BounceBroom principal. Verification requires approval from the on-call lead. Once approved, the console prompts for the stored recovery credentials; enter the passphrase that appears directly below this paragraph.

recovery phrase for fahof-kahap: holion-gormir-jorix-istix-briwyn-sorael

Ticket: Velmora calendar sync is double-booking folks again. When a meeting gets moved on the desktop client while the phone is offline, the phone pushes the stale copy back up and both versions stick around. Users see two identical events an hour apart. Workaround for support: delete the older event manually. Proper fix lands in the next sync release — reference the build token below in replies.

build token for kagaf-hahof: htk14_9d3d4d26d7d8de